// private helper classes and functions
namespace {
}
namespace ViewActions {
// exported helper functions
void DoZoomFit(AudacityProject &project)
{
auto &viewInfo = project.GetViewInfo();
auto tracks = project.GetTracks();
const double start = viewInfo.bScrollBeyondZero
? std::min(tracks->GetStartTime(), 0.0)
: 0;
project.Zoom( project.GetZoomOfToFit() );
project.TP_ScrollWindow(start);
}
void DoZoomFitV(AudacityProject &project)
{
auto trackPanel = project.GetTrackPanel();
auto tracks = project.GetTracks();
// Only nonminimized audio tracks will be resized
auto range = tracks->Any<AudioTrack>() - &Track::GetMinimized;
auto count = range.size();
if (count == 0)
return;
// Find total height to apportion
int height;
trackPanel->GetTracksUsableArea(NULL, &height);
height -= 28;
// The height of minimized and non-audio tracks cannot be apportioned
height -=
tracks->Any().sum( &Track::GetHeight ) - range.sum( &Track::GetHeight );
// Give each resized track the average of the remaining height
height = height / count;
height = std::max( (int)TrackInfo::MinimumTrackHeight(), height );
for (auto t : range)
t->SetHeight(height);
}
